跨站脚本攻击(XSS)是一种常见的网络安全威胁,它允许攻击者在用户的浏览器中注入恶意脚本。在本教程中,我们将通过一个简单的实例来学习如何在JSP页面中防止XSS攻击。
假设我们有一个简单的用户留言板,用户可以在文本框中输入留言,然后提交。为了防止XSS攻击,我们需要确保用户输入的内容在显示到页面上时不会被当作HTML标签执行。
我们创建一个简单的HTML表单,包含一个文本框和一个提交按钮。
```html
在Java Web开发中,JSP(JavaServer Pages)是常用的技术之一。虚拟路径是JSP技术中的一个重要特性,它允许开发者将Web应用程序中的资源(如JSP页面、图片、CSS文件等)映射到服务器上的特定目录。...
教程概述本教程将带领您通过JSP技术实现一个简单的留言板动态回复功能。我们将使用JSP页面、Servlet和数据库来存储和展示留言,并实现留言的动态回复。 准备工作在开始之前,请确保您有以下准备工作: 安装并配置好Java...
概述本教程将向您展示如何使用JSP技术实现一个简单的后台用户权限管理实例。我们将使用Servlet和JSP页面来创建一个用户登录界面,并根据用户权限显示不同的内容。 准备工作- 安装Java开发环境(如JDK)- 配置We...
简介本教程将展示如何使用JSP和Java代码来实现一个简单的商品分页功能。我们将通过一个示例来学习如何获取当前页码、计算总页数以及如何展示分页导航链接。 前提条件 熟悉JSP基本语法 熟悉Java编程基础 了解Servle...
JSP实现禁用账户实例教程在这个教程中,我们将学习如何使用JSP(Java Server Pages)来创建一个简单的用户账户禁用功能。这个实例将展示如何禁用用户账户,并在用户尝试登录时检查账户状态。 准备工作在开始之前,...
在JSP中实现访问次数的记录,可以通过在服务器端存储一个变量来实现。以下是一个简单的实例教程,展示如何使用JSP和Servlet来记录页面访问次数。 实例教程 1. 创建一个简单的JSP页面创建一个名为`index.jsp`...
在JSP页面中,实现条件组合查询是常见的需求。以下是一个简单的实例教程,我们将通过一个图书查询系统来展示如何使用JSP和JavaBean来实现动态数据筛选。 一、项目准备1. JDK安装:确保你的开发环境已经安装了Java...
在JSP页面中,校验日期格式是一个常见的需求。以下是一个简单的实例,展示如何使用JSP和JavaScript来校验日期格式。 准备工作- 确保你的开发环境中已经安装了JSP支持。- 创建一个新的JSP文件,例如`date-...